What Is an Access Control System?
An access control system manages who can enter or exit specific areas of a building. It replaces traditional keys with electronic verification methods such as keycards, biometric scans, or mobile credentials. Modern systems often include advanced security solutions that enhance convenience, monitoring, and overall protection.
- User authentication
- Access logging
- Remote monitoring
- Integration with alarms, cameras, and building management systems
These systems not only protect physical assets but also enhance employee safety and operational control.

Types of Access Control Systems
Choosing the right type depends on business needs, size, and security requirements:
1. Card-Based Systems
- Proximity Cards: Tap-to-enter cards
- Magnetic Stripe Cards: Swipe cards requiring close interaction
- Smart Cards: Embedded chips for enhanced security
2. Biometric Systems
- Fingerprint Readers: Fast, user-specific verification
- Facial Recognition: Non-contact and secure for high-traffic zones
- Iris Scans: Highly secure for sensitive areas
3. Mobile Credential Systems
- Use smartphones with Bluetooth or NFC
- Enable temporary or remote access for contractors or visitors
- Integrate with employee management systems
4. Keypad or PIN Systems
- Require users to input a numerical code
- Cost-effective for small offices or secondary entrances
- Can be combined with card or biometric verification for multi-factor security

Integration with Existing Security Infrastructure
Modern access control systems often integrate with:
- Video Surveillance: Link access events with camera footage
- Alarm Systems: Trigger alerts during unauthorized access attempts
- Time and Attendance Systems: Track employee presence for HR and payroll
- Smart Building Management: Control HVAC, lighting, and other automated systems
Seamless integration enhances overall security while improving operational efficiency.
Compliance and Legal Considerations in San Francisco
Businesses must comply with federal, state, and local regulations:
- California Consumer Privacy Act (CCPA): Protects personal information, relevant for biometric data storage
- Occupational Safety and Health Administration (OSHA): Ensures safe access and emergency exits
- Local Building Codes: Specify access control requirements in commercial properties
- ADA Compliance: Ensure accessibility for all employees and visitors
Adhering to legal standards reduces liability and enhances trust among employees and clients.
Installation and Maintenance Best Practices
Proper setup ensures system reliability:
- Professional Installation: Certified technicians ensure wiring, devices, and integration meet standards
- Regular Updates: Firmware and software updates prevent vulnerabilities
- Periodic Testing: Test credentials, access logs, and alert systems
- Backup Systems: Implement fail-safes like mechanical keys or battery backups
Routine maintenance extends system lifespan and preserves security integrity.
